The numbers are not good enough to really demand a premium IMO. If you had gotten 08776680 maybe that would have gotten a little over face. It's hard to sell $20's for a premium unless they really have something special about the serial number or age&condition. If the numbers had been 88776655 in GEM condition then you might have scored a little extra. Keep looking and good luck! ~ Darryl
